Online Marketing Strategies
One of the primary methods for promoting a blockchain ecosystem is through online marketing. This includes search engine optimization (SEO), content marketing, social media campaigns, and paid advertising. SEO is particularly crucial as it helps in driving organic traffic to your platform or website.
SEO Optimization Investing in SEO can yield significant returns in terms of visibility and cost-effectiveness. A study by Backlinko found that websites ranking on the first page of Google receive an average of 5x more clicks than those on the second page. To optimize for SEO, focus on keyword research, quality content creation, backlink building, and technical SEO improvements.
Content Marketing Content marketing plays a pivotal role in educating potential users about your ecosystem. High-quality blog posts, whitepapers, infographics, and videos can help establish authority and build trust within your target audience. For instance, Ethereum's educational content has been instrumental in promoting its platform globally.
Social Media Campaigns Social media platforms like Twitter, LinkedIn, Facebook, and Reddit are powerful tools for reaching out to a broader audience. Engaging with communities relevant to blockchain technology can help in spreading awareness about your ecosystem. A well-executed social media campaign can significantly reduce costs compared to traditional advertising methods.
Paid Advertising Paid advertising through platforms like Google Ads or social media ads can provide immediate results but comes with its own set of costs. The cost per click (CPC) varies based on competition and bidding strategies. For instance, bidding on high-traffic keywords related to blockchain technology can be quite expensive.
Partnerships and Community Engagement
Collaborating with other players in the industry can amplify your reach and credibility. Partnerships with established companies or organizations can provide access to their user base and resources.
Community Engagement Building a strong community around your ecosystem is essential for long-term success. Engaging with users through forums like Reddit or Discord can foster loyalty and organic growth. Community events such as hackathons or meetups also help in promoting your ecosystem while fostering innovation.
Case Studies
To illustrate the cost implications of promoting an international blockchain ecosystem, let's consider two case studies:
- Ethereum: Ethereum has invested heavily in community engagement and online marketing strategies over the years. Their extensive content library has helped educate millions about blockchain technology while their active community has driven organic growth.
- Cardano: Cardano has focused on building partnerships with universities and research institutions worldwide to promote their platform's academic rigor. This approach has helped them establish credibility among industry experts.
